.elementor-11 .elementor-element.elementor-element-e3a083d > .elementor-container{max-width:800px;}.elementor-11 .elementor-element.elementor-element-e3a083d{margin-top:70px;margin-bottom:70px;}:root{--page-title-display:none;}.elementor-widget .tippy-tooltip .tippy-content{text-align:center;}@media(max-width:767px){.elementor-11 .elementor-element.elementor-element-e3a083d{margin-top:10px;margin-bottom:10px;}}/* Start custom CSS */.woocommerce-Address-title .edit{
    padding:5px;
    border: 1px solid #000;
}
.woocommerce-Address-title .edit:hover{
    padding: 5px;
    border: 1px solid #000;
    background:#0e0d3b;
    color:#fff;
}
.yith-wcmap .user-profile .user-info .logout{
    margin-top:15px;
}
.yith-wcmap .user-profile .user-info .logout a{
    padding: 5px 50px!important;
    font-size: 100%!important;
    background: #001c38!important;
}

.yith-wcmap .user-profile .user-info .logout a:hover{
    background: #afada9!important;
}

/*註冊登入頁面*/
/* 登入/註冊分頁切換樣式 */
.login-register-tabs {
	display: flex;
	justify-content: center;
	margin-bottom: 20px;
	gap: 10px;
  }
  .login-register-tabs button {
	padding: 10px 30px;
	font-weight: bold;
	background: #ccc;
	border: none;
	cursor: pointer;
	border-radius: 5px;
	color: #333;
	transition: background 0.3s ease, color 0.3s ease;
  }
  
  /* 登入模式下：登入藍色 */
  .login-register-tabs.login-active .login-tab-btn {
	background-color: #03264c;
	color: #fff;
  }
  
  /* 註冊模式下：註冊紅色 */
  .login-register-tabs.register-active .register-tab-btn {
	background-color: #DC3545;
	color: #fff;
  }
  
  /* 非選取狀態維持灰色 */
  .login-register-tabs .tab-btn:not(.active) {
	background-color: #eee;
	color: #666;
  }
  
  /* 表單容器欄位調整 */
  #customer_login .u-column1,
  #customer_login .u-column2 {
	width: 100% !important;
	float: none !important;
  }

  /*登入按鈕*/
  .woocommerce-form-login__submit {
	font-size: 18px;
	padding: .818em 1em!important;
	min-width: 200px;
	border-radius: 6px;
	background-color: #0071a1; /* 可自定顏色 */
	color: white;
	display: inline-block;
	margin: 20px auto 0;
  }

  /*註冊按鈕*/
  .woocommerce-form-register__submit {
	font-size: 18px;
	padding: .818em 1em!important;
	min-width: 200px;
	border-radius: 6px;
	background-color: #0e0d3b; /* 紅色，可自定 */
	color: white;
	display: inline-block;
	margin: 20px auto 0;
	font-size: 17px!important
  }
  
  /* hover 效果 */
  .woocommerce-form-register__submit:hover {
	background-color: #0e0d3b!important;
	color: #d7d7d7!important;
  }
  
  
/*我的帳號按鈕字種*/
div.nsl-container .nsl-button-default{
	font-weight:600;
}
  
  @media screen and (min-width:1200px) {
      #customer_login .u-column1,
  #customer_login .u-column2 {
	width: 70% !important;
	float: none !important;
	margin:0 auto;
  }
  }
  
 /*貨態*/
 .woocommerce-account .woocommerce-MyAccount-content mark.order-status {
    background-color: #1abc9c;
    color: #ffffff;
 }
 
 .order-number,.order-date {
     margin-left:-3px !important;
 }/* End custom CSS */